    Why Doesn't My Child Listen to Me?

    Welcome to Hot Topics! In this episode, host Gabrielle Crichlow and guest Dr. David Marcus tackle the common frustrations parents face when their children seem unresponsive. They explore the underlying reasons for this disconnect, including developmental stages, communication styles, and emotional needs. Additionally, they provide actionable strategies to help parents improve their communication skills. Listeners will learn how to foster a more open dialogue, develop a common emotional language, utilize active listening techniques, and create a supportive environment that strengthens family connections. Who is Dr. David Marcus? In today’s challenging world, parents require new tools to help their children develop a healthy self-image and emotional resilience. Many still use parenting techniques from their own upbringing, which often do not apply to current issues like the impact of social media, financial stress, and the challenges of dual-income households. Dr. David Marcus, a Clinical Psychologist with over 40 years of experience, offers valuable insights into developing effective emotional communication between parents and children. He provides step-by-step strategies tailored for various stages of child development, focusing on how to help parents create a common emotional language, tolerate intense emotions through the “empty-out process,” and serve as a “Soothing Presence” for their children. Additionally, he discusses avoiding common parenting mistakes, understanding the emotional impact of high-conflict situations, and distinguishing effective discipline from punishment, making him a sought-after resource in the Cincinnati area on parent-child communication and child advocacy.     Simple Natural Health Solutions (Part 3)

    Welcome to Hot Topics! Join host Gabrielle Crichlow and guest Sarah Dawkins as they explore the world of holistic healing, which focuses on the connections between mind, body, and spirit, providing natural health solutions without relying on pharmaceuticals. In this episode, they discuss the link between thyroid health and the psychological barriers to self-expression, showing how difficulty in asserting oneself can lead to thyroid issues. The conversation also covers dietary changes, highlighting how cutting out dairy and gluten can help with chronic problems like acid reflux and eczema. Gabrielle and Sarah delve into alternative therapies, showcasing the benefits of acupuncture and chiropractic care, as well as the importance of healing the inner child to overcome PTSD. Viewers will gain practical tips for adopting a chemical-free lifestyle, learning how to swap harmful products for natural alternatives in their homes. Additionally, viewers will discover the benefits of adding sea moss or sea kelp to their diets to support thyroid health, and eating frequent small meals to support adrenal health. This episode serves as a helpful guide to well-being, empowering viewers to reclaim their health and embrace a more balanced life.  Who is Sarah Dawkins? Sarah Dawkins is a passionate Holistic Health and Healing Coach, international speaker and author of Heal Yourself. She’s also a multi-award-winning entrepreneur and the award-winning host of the uplifting podcast Mind Body Medicine for Self Healers. With over 20 years’ experience as a Registered Nurse, Sarah combines her deep understanding of conventional medicine with her own powerful self-healing journey to create a truly integrative approach. Having overcome multiple chronic health challenges herself, she now supports others in uncovering and addressing the root causes of their symptoms, helping them restore balance, reclaim their energy and create lasting, vibrant wellness. .     The GUIDE Framework

    Welcome to Hot Topics! In this episode, host Gabrielle Crichlow welcomes back guest Robin Simpson for her unprecedented 7th visit to the podcast! Together, they explore "The GUIDE Framework," Robin's doctoral dissertation that provides a structured approach for neurodivergent students to navigate the complexities of academia by effectively leveraging AI tools like ChatGPT. They discuss the pivotal moments students often encounter when they sit down to tackle assignments. Do you find yourself freezing in front of a blank document, getting sidetracked, or overanalyzing the instructions? If so, this episode is designed just for you!  Who is Robin Simpson? Robin Renee Simpson holds an Associate degree in Human Services from New York City College of Technology and a Bachelor’s degree from Metropolitan College. She earned her Master’s degree in Childhood and Special Education (Birth–Grade 2) from St. John’s University in 2022. She is currently a doctoral candidate in Curriculum and Instruction, pursuing a PhD in Education with a focus in Philosophy of Education. She is an adjunct professor and the creator of the GUIDE Framework (Simpson, 2024), a structured approach to using generative AI to support student learning. In addition to her academic work, she is a Residential Family Group Daycare owner and a Master Life Coach. Her work focuses on social justice in education and supporting twice-exceptional learners, with an emphasis on helping students understand how they think and learn.
